    The City of Milwaukee has been award-ed a $1 million state grant for the develop-ment of Reed Street Yards, a water technol-ogy business park now under constructionadjacent to the Global Water Center.

    In addition, the Wisconsin EconomicDevelopment Corporation (WEDC) hasagreed to provide up to $2 million in statetax credits to Rexnord Corp. to support thecompany’s relocation of its Zurn Industriessubsidiary to Reed Street Yards. The reloca-

    tion is expected to create 120 new jobs.The WEDC grant to the city will be usedto help fund environmental site work andgeotechnical activities on the 17-acre site inthe Menomonee Valley. Once completed,Reed Street Yards, located in Milwaukee’sWalker’s Point neighborhood, will be hometo a mixed-use urban office, educational,research and technology complex that willfocus on the international water industry.

    “Reed Street Yards will complement theoutstanding work already taking place atthe nearby Global Water Center and willfurther solidify the position of Milwaukeeand Wisconsin as a world leader in watertechnology,” said Lt. Governor RebeccaKleefisch, who made the announcementwith city and industry officials on Tuesday.“The state is proud to play a key role in mov-

    ing this project forward.”“Businesses are choosing Milwaukeebecause it is a great place to grow. Theyrecognize the advantages in our culture of hard work and innovation,” said MilwaukeeMayor Tom Barrett, who joined Kleefisch atthe announcement. “With the combinedresources of the state and the city, we cansmooth the way for companies to locatehere. That adds jobs to our economy andbenefits our entire region.”

    Located on the south bank of theMenomonee River, Reed Street Yards isexpected to ultimately house more than 1million square feet of space and will join theGlobal Water Center as the physical hub of an international water technology cluster.Developer Peter Moede and GeneralCapital Group will begin construction laterthis year on a four-story, 80,000-squarefoot multiuse building called Water TechOne. The $20 million building, which has

    been designed with uncompromising atten-tion to sustainability and cutting edge water,energy and technology features, is expect-ed to be completed in 2016.

    Rexnord Corp. is relocating ZurnIndustries to a 52,000-square-foot stand-alone office building in Reed Street Yards.Construction on that building is expected tobegin this year. WEDC has authorized thecompany to receive up to $2 million in taxcredits. The actual amount of credits thecompany will earn is contingent upon thecompany meeting specific job creation andwage requirements.

    “As we establish the Zurn headquartersin Milwaukee, we greatly appreciate thetremendous support that we have receivedfrom both the State of Wisconsin and City of Milwaukee,” said Todd Adams, Rexnord

    president and CEO. “Rexnord anticipatescontinued growth and expansion of ourwater businesses as we believe Wisconsinand Milwaukee have created an ecosystemfor water technology companies to accessworld-class talent, innovation and technolo-gy development, as well as research part-nerships that will help shape and addressthe world’s water challenges.”

    B Y  MELINDA  M YERS

    Spots on tomatoes, holes in hostaleaves and wilting stems mean insects and

    diseases have moved into the garden. Don’tlet these intruders reduce the beauty andproductivity of your landscape. Work inconcert with nature to prevent and controlthese pests and you will be rewarded witha bountiful harvest and landscape filledwith beautiful blooms.

    Monitor. Take regular walks throughthe landscape. Not only is it good exer-cise, but it will improve your mood andyou’ll discover problems earlier whenthey are easier to control. Look for discol-ored leaves, spots, holes and wilting.Inspect the underside of the leaves andalong the stems to uncover the cause of the problem.

    Identify. Once you discover a prob-lem, identify the culprit. Your local exten-

    sion service, garden center or reliableinternet resource can help. Once identi-fied, you can plan the best way to man-age the culprit.

    Invite the Good Guys. Toads,lady beetles and birds help control manygarden pests. Attract them to the gardenby planting herbs and flowers to attractbeneficial insects, adding a house for thetoads, and birdbath for songbirds. Avoidusing pesticides and learn to tolerate a bitof damage. A few aphids or caterpillarswill bring in the ladybeetles, lacewings,birds and toads that are looking for ameal.

    Clean up. Many insects and dis-eases can be managed and preventedwith a bit of garden cleanup. A strongblast of water from the garden hose willdislodge aphids and mites, reducing theirdamage to a tolerable level. Or knockleaf-eating beetles and other larger

    insects off the plants and into a can of soapy water.

    Pick off discolored leaves, prune off diseased stems and destroy. Be sure todisinfect tools with 70% alcohol or onepart bleach to nine parts water solutionbetween cuts. This will reduce the risk of spreading the disease when pruninginfected plants.

    Adjust care. Reduce the spread

    and risk of further problems by adjustingyour maintenance strategies. Avoid over-head and nighttime watering that canincrease the risk of disease. Use an

    organic nitrogen fertilizer like Milorganite(milorganite.com) which encourages slowsteady growth that is less susceptible toinsect and disease attacks.

    Mulch the soil with shredded leaves,evergreen needles or woodchips. This willkeep roots cool and moist during drought,improve the soil as they decompose, andalso prevent soil borne diseases fromsplashing onto and infecting the plants.

    Non-chemical Controls. If theproblems continue, try some non-chemi-cal options for insects. A yellow bowlfilled with soapy water can attract aphids,a shallow can filled with beer and sunk inthe ground will manage slugs, and crum-pled paper under a flower pot for ear-wigs are just a few ways to trap and kill

    these pests.Or cover the plants with floating row

    covers. These fabrics allow air, light andwater through, but prevent insects likebean beetles and cabbage worms fromreaching and damaging the plants.

    Organic products. Organic prod-ucts like insecticidal soap, Neem, horti-culture oil and Bacillus thuringiensis canbe used to control specific pests. And

    The Better Business Bureau ServingWisconsin has received recent reports of phantom debt collectors — callers posing asdebt collectors — and is warning consumersabout the relentless scandal involving fakedebt collection calls.

    It usually begins with a telephone callduring which you’re told you owe moneyon a current or old debt you don’t remem-

    ber, you paid in the past, or a debt t hat isn’teven yours. Consumers say the callersattempt to collect and often threaten tohave you arrested unless you pay up. Theyare aggressive, intimidating, and very con-vincing.

    The callers pose as legitimate debt col-lectors and may even have a few tidbits of personal information, such as the last fourdigits of your Social Security number. Thatdoes not mean it is a legitimate call and thecaller may even ask for more personal orfinancial information as part of the spiel.

    “Unfortunately, some victims will payout of fear, even if they believe they paidthe debt, just to stop the harassing calls,”says Ran Hoth, CEO and president. “Insome cases these payments can run into

    the hundreds or even thousands of dollars.If you’re not careful, ID theft can be one of the consequences of interacting with a debtscammer.”

    Under the Fair Debt CollectionPractices Act, debt collectors may not callbetween 9 pm and 8 am unless you givethem permission to do so. They are alsoprohibited from using abusive, unfair, ordeceptive practices to collect from you,enforced by the Federal Trade Commission(FTC). This will help you with a legitimatedebt collector, but how can you tell if thedebt collection call is legitimate?

    Take control - Ask for the caller’sname, company street address and tele-phone number, and say you have nothingelse to discuss until you receive a

    Validation Notice which is proof of thedebt and the name of the creditor andamount owed.

    Don’t confirm any information— The caller may ask you to verify the lastfour digits of your SSN or ask for banking,date of birth and other information. Don’tconfirm or deny.

    Don’t trust caller ID — Caller ID canbe easily manipulated to display whatevername or phone number the scammerschoose.

    Call the creditor — The debt may be

    legitimate — but if you think the collector isrogue or a criminal- let the company thatyou owe money to know about it.

    Report the call —If it is an identifi-able company with a Wisconsin address —file a complaint with BBB.org. If not, file a
